AI Adoption Roadmap: A 90-Day Plan From Pilot to Measurable Value

An AI adoption roadmap turns one business problem into a controlled 90-day implementation. It names the outcome, workflow owner, baseline, pilot scope, human review, risks, measures, and decision gates. The goal is not company-wide transformation. It is evidence that one useful workflow should scale, change, or stop.

Updated August 19, 2026

TL;DR: Choose one workflow tied to revenue, cost, speed, or customer experience. Spend days 1–30 understanding the current work and defining a narrow pilot. Use days 31–60 to run it with human oversight. Use days 61–90 to compare results with the baseline and decide whether to scale, revise, or stop. Do not buy a collection of tools and call it a strategy.

What is an AI adoption roadmap?

An AI adoption roadmap is a sequence of business decisions that moves AI from scattered experiments into useful, governed work. It tells the team what problem comes first, who owns it, what evidence justifies investment, how people stay in control, and what result permits the next step.

That is different from an AI wish list. A wish list says, “Use AI in sales, marketing, operations, and finance.” A roadmap says, “For 30 days, test whether a reviewed meeting-summary workflow can reduce follow-up preparation time without creating inaccurate customer commitments. The sales operations lead owns the result. We scale only if the quality and time thresholds are met.”

Adoption is already broad, but business value still lags. McKinsey’s November 2025 global survey found that 88% of respondents said their organizations regularly used AI in at least one business function. Yet only about one-third said their organizations had begun scaling AI programs, and just 39% attributed any level of enterprise-wide EBIT impact to AI. Source: McKinsey, The State of AI: Global Survey 2025, accessed August 19, 2026.

That gap is the reason to build a roadmap. Access to AI is no longer the scarce part. Clear ownership, workflow redesign, reliable information, staff confidence, and disciplined measurement are.

A useful roadmap should answer seven questions:

  • Which business outcome matters now?
  • Which workflow most directly affects it?
  • What is the current baseline?
  • What will AI do, and what will a person still decide?
  • Which failure modes need controls?
  • How will the team know whether the pilot worked?
  • Who decides to scale, revise, or stop?

If the document cannot answer those questions in plain language, it is not ready for approval.

What should be true before day one?

Start with a business constraint, not a tool. “We need an AI agent” is a purchase preference. “Qualified inquiries wait six hours for a useful response” is a business problem. The second statement gives you a customer effect, an observable workflow, and a baseline you can improve.

Pick one outcome from a short list:

  • Increase qualified opportunities or won revenue.
  • Reduce cycle time or avoidable operating cost.
  • Improve response time, service quality, or retention.
  • Reclaim staff capacity from repetitive administration.
  • Reduce errors, rework, or compliance exposure.

Then identify the workflow that contributes directly to that outcome. Watch the work happen. Speak with the people who perform it. Collect five to ten normal examples and at least two awkward ones. Note where information arrives, where it is copied, where judgment is required, where work waits, and where mistakes become expensive.

Do not skip the baseline. If the goal is faster proposals, measure the current median time from approved scope to sent proposal. If the goal is fewer missed inquiries, measure the share of valid inquiries without an owner after one hour. If the goal is faster reporting, measure preparation hours and the number of corrections after review.

The baseline should include one result measure and at least one quality guardrail. Time saved is not useful if error rates rise. Faster replies are not useful if customers receive confident nonsense. More leads are not useful if the sales team spends its week disqualifying them.

Small businesses are not waiting for perfect certainty. The U.S. Chamber of Commerce’s 2025 small-business technology report found that 58% of surveyed small businesses said they used generative AI, up from 40% in 2024 and 23% in 2023. The same report found that only 8% primarily developed AI in-house, while 63% mostly or entirely relied on tools built by other companies. Source: U.S. Chamber of Commerce, Empowering Small Business 2025, accessed August 19, 2026.

The practical lesson is simple: your roadmap does not need an internal research lab. It needs a sensible decision about where standard software is enough and where your workflow requires configuration, integration, or a custom build.

Before day one, appoint four roles even if one person holds several of them:

  1. Executive owner: accountable for the business outcome and final decision.
  2. Workflow owner: understands the daily work and can change the process.
  3. Quality reviewer: checks outputs and records failure patterns.
  4. Implementation owner: configures tools, connections, permissions, and reporting.

“The team owns it” means nobody owns it. Put names beside the roles.

What happens during days 1–30?

The first month is for understanding, narrowing, and designing. Resist the urge to launch quickly just because a demo looked impressive.

Week one maps the current workflow. Record its trigger, steps, decisions, systems, handoffs, exceptions, completion rule, and metrics. Separate official policy from actual behavior. The spreadsheet someone keeps privately may matter more than the process diagram in a shared drive.

Week two identifies the smallest useful pilot. A good pilot has enough volume to produce evidence but a small enough blast radius that errors remain manageable. Choose one team, one customer segment, one document type, or one source of requests. Avoid a company-wide launch.

Define the AI role in one sentence. Examples include:

  • Classify incoming requests and suggest an owner.
  • Prepare a draft response using approved knowledge.
  • Summarize a meeting and extract proposed next actions.
  • Flag records missing required information.
  • Assemble a weekly report from agreed sources.

Now define the human role. A person may approve customer-facing messages, resolve low-confidence cases, accept extracted actions, review exceptions, or make pricing and policy decisions. Human oversight must be a real step with an owner and a time limit, not a footnote saying “review as needed.”

Week three sets acceptance criteria. Write what good output looks like and how it will be checked. Include accuracy, completeness, tone, timeliness, permission, and traceability where relevant. Test the proposed workflow with historical examples before exposing it to live work.

Week four prepares operations. Train the pilot group. Explain the business problem, what the system does, what it cannot decide, where feedback goes, and how to pause it. Set up a simple log for incorrect outputs, missing information, workarounds, customer complaints, and manual effort.

At the end of day 30, hold the first gate. Proceed only if:

  • The baseline is credible.
  • The pilot population is defined.
  • The workflow and ownership are clear.
  • Output acceptance criteria exist.
  • Human review and escalation are staffed.
  • Required data and permissions are available.
  • The team can pause or reverse the pilot.

If two departments still disagree about the process, do not automate the disagreement. Fix the rule first.

What happens during days 31–60?

The second month is a controlled live pilot. The job is to learn whether the workflow creates value under normal operating pressure, including the ugly cases that never appear in a sales demo.

Start with a limited cohort. Review the first outputs closely. For a low-volume workflow, inspect every case. For higher volume, review a meaningful sample plus every exception and complaint. Record the original input, system output, human correction, time spent, and final outcome.

Track three levels of evidence:

  • Operation: did the workflow run when it should?
  • Quality: was the output accurate, useful, and appropriate?
  • Business: did cycle time, cost, revenue, or customer experience improve?

Do not confuse the first with the third. “The automation processed 1,000 records” proves activity. It does not prove better decisions, happier customers, or saved money.

Review the pilot weekly with the people doing the work. Ask what they stopped doing, what new work appeared, and where they no longer trust the output. A system may save ten minutes of drafting but create fifteen minutes of checking. It may make standard cases faster while making exceptions harder. It may improve a manager’s report while shifting data cleanup onto frontline staff.

Change one major variable at a time. If you replace the tool, rewrite the process, change the team, and alter the target metric in the same week, you will not know what caused the result.

This is also when governance becomes practical. Review who can see which data, which sources the system may use, how long records are retained, which actions need approval, and what happens when the output is uncertain. For customer-facing or consequential work, define the point at which a person must intervene.

Microsoft’s 2026 Work Trend Index surveyed 20,000 knowledge workers who use AI across ten markets. Only 19% fell into the report’s “Frontier” group, where individual readiness and organizational capability were both high. Just 26% said leadership was clearly and consistently aligned on AI. Source: Microsoft, 2026 Work Trend Index, accessed August 19, 2026.

That is a management warning. Adoption fails when leadership announces a grand ambition but employees receive unclear rules, weak training, and no safe way to challenge the system. A roadmap must build capability and trust alongside software.

At day 60, hold the second gate. Continue only if the pilot operates reliably enough to measure, users understand their responsibilities, exceptions are visible, and there is early evidence that the business metric can move without damaging the guardrails.

What happens during days 61–90?

The final month is not “roll out everywhere.” It is measurement, correction, and a decision.

Compare the pilot with the baseline using the same definition and a similar population. If inquiry response time was measured during business hours before the pilot, do not compare it with a 24-hour average afterward. If the pilot handled only straightforward cases, do not claim it represents the full workflow.

Calculate the visible benefit:

  • Hours removed from repeatable work.
  • Cycle time reduced.
  • Errors or rework avoided.
  • Additional qualified opportunities advanced.
  • Customer response or resolution improved.
  • Operating cost avoided.

Then subtract the new burden:

  • Human review time.
  • Exception handling.
  • Tool administration.
  • Training and support.
  • Additional risk or compliance work.
  • Ongoing software and implementation cost.

Record what cannot yet be known. A 90-day pilot may show faster lead handling but not completed revenue if the sales cycle lasts six months. Report leading evidence honestly and set a later review date for the lagging outcome.

During weeks nine and ten, fix the highest-frequency failure that threatens the result. Do not polish every edge case. During week eleven, run the revised workflow without extraordinary supervision. If it works only when the project owner watches every case, it is not ready to scale.

Week twelve prepares the decision memo. Keep it to one or two pages:

  • Problem and original baseline.
  • Pilot scope and owner.
  • What changed in the workflow.
  • Results and guardrails.
  • New costs and displaced work.
  • Known risks and unresolved questions.
  • Recommendation: scale, revise, or stop.
  • Next review date and accountable owner.

Stopping is a valid outcome. A weak pilot can save the business from a large, expensive mistake. Revising is valid when the problem matters but the workflow, data, or control needs work. Scaling is justified only when the result survives normal use and the team can support it.

What does the complete 90-day roadmap look like?

Use this table as the operating page for the project. Add names, dates, metrics, and links to evidence. If a row has no owner or exit condition, the roadmap has a hole.

PeriodMain jobRequired outputDecision gate
Days 1–10Define outcome and map current workBaseline, workflow map, pain evidence, named ownersIs the problem specific and worth solving?
Days 11–20Design the smallest useful pilotPilot cohort, AI role, human role, acceptance criteriaCan the pilot be controlled and reversed?
Days 21–30Test examples and prepare the teamHistorical test results, training, escalation and pause planAre data, people and controls ready?
Days 31–45Run a limited live pilotOutput reviews, exception log, user feedbackDoes the workflow operate safely?
Days 46–60Measure early value and correct failureOperational, quality and business evidenceIs there enough signal to continue?
Days 61–75Compare with baseline and include full burdenBenefit, cost, displaced work and risk analysisDoes the net result justify more work?
Days 76–90Prove normal operation and decideDecision memo and next-stage ownerScale, revise, or stop?

The table is deliberately boring. Good operating systems usually are. Excitement belongs in the outcome; clarity belongs in the plan.

How should leaders choose whether to scale, revise, or stop?

Use a written rule before the pilot begins. Otherwise sunk cost and executive enthusiasm will rewrite the standard after results arrive.

Scale when the target metric improves, quality guardrails remain healthy, the process works without heroic supervision, ownership is clear, and the ongoing cost is justified. Expand to one adjacent team or use case, not the entire company. Recheck the result after volume and complexity increase.

Revise when the business problem remains valuable but one correctable constraint blocks the outcome. Examples include missing source data, unclear review criteria, a slow approval, weak training, or a pilot population that was too broad. Name the change, keep the original baseline, and set a short extension.

Stop when the problem was smaller than expected, users reject the workflow for sound reasons, quality cannot meet the threshold, the control burden erases the benefit, or a simpler non-AI change solves the issue. Document the learning so the same idea does not return six months later wearing a different product name.

Never scale because a vendor demo succeeded. Never stop because one user dislikes change. Use evidence from normal work.

Which mistakes derail AI adoption?

The first mistake is starting with too many use cases. A ten-item roadmap is usually ten under-owned experiments. One measured workflow teaches the organization more than a quarter of enthusiastic trials.

The second is treating adoption as a software installation. A tool can be configured in days; roles, habits, decisions, and trust take deliberate work. If the team does not understand when to rely on the system and when to intervene, usage will become either reckless or superficial.

The third is measuring usage instead of value. Logins, prompts, and processed records show activity. Connect them to cycle time, revenue, quality, cost, or customer experience.

The fourth is hiding exceptions. Average performance can look excellent while a small class of failures creates serious customer or regulatory risk. Review the tails, not only the average.

The fifth is buying new tools before simplifying the process. If a report exists because three managers request overlapping updates, automate after deciding which update matters. Otherwise the system produces unnecessary work faster.

The sixth is vague ownership. Every live workflow needs someone accountable for the business result, someone responsible for daily operation, and someone authorized to pause it.

The seventh is skipping the stop rule. A roadmap without a stop decision is a budget request disguised as a plan.

What are the frequently asked questions about an AI adoption roadmap?

How long should an AI adoption roadmap cover?

Use 90 days for the first operating cycle. It is long enough to map the workflow, run a controlled pilot, and evaluate evidence, but short enough to prevent a vague transformation program. Maintain a longer strategic view only after the first use case proves how your organization adopts AI in practice.

How many AI use cases should the first roadmap include?

One. A second use case is reasonable only when it shares the same owner, data, controls, and success measure. Most small and midsize businesses learn faster by completing one full decision cycle than by launching several pilots that never reach measurement.

Do we need an AI readiness assessment first?

You need a focused readiness check for the selected workflow. Confirm that the problem is real, the process can be described, the required information exists, the owner can change the work, users can participate, and risks can be controlled. A company-wide assessment is useful only when the planned scope is genuinely company-wide.

Should we buy AI software before creating the roadmap?

Usually no. Define the outcome, workflow, data, human decisions, and acceptance criteria first. Then compare tools against those requirements. Existing software may already cover the need. Buying early encourages the team to reshape the problem around the product.

What metrics belong in the roadmap?

Use one business result, one or two leading measures, one quality guardrail, and the full operating burden. For example: customer resolutions completed, time to first useful response, percentage requiring rework, and weekly review hours. Keep definitions consistent before and after the pilot.

Who should own AI adoption in a small business?

The business leader accountable for the outcome should sponsor it, while the manager closest to the workflow should own daily operation. A technical partner can implement the system, but should not decide what customer, revenue, quality, or risk outcome counts as success.

What is the difference between an AI strategy and an AI adoption roadmap?

Strategy explains why AI matters to the business and where it may create advantage. The adoption roadmap turns that direction into sequenced work: one outcome, one workflow, named owners, a pilot, controls, measures, and decision gates. Strategy chooses the destination. The roadmap determines the next controlled move.
